Following the tabling of the EDM on the prohibition of the import and display of cetaceans into the UK, Mike Hancock MP submitted a question at the House of Commons Hansard (“Debates”) in May 2007. Read the Minister's answer to his question here
Marine Connection has written to Jonathan Shaw MP, Minister for the Marine Environment, Landscape & Rural Affairs calling for a ban on the importation and display of cetaceans into the UK which is supported by colleagues worldwide. List of signatories
